Mapping Constructively Aligned Curriculum and Instructional Design offers a timely and comprehensive framework for educators, instructional designers, and academic leaders seeking to create meaningful and measurable learning experiences. Grounded in transdisciplinary communication and informed by decades of practice in secondary, postsecondary, and graduate education, this book bridges theory and application to address the evolving challenges of curriculum design in an era of rapid innovation, accountability, and systemic change. At the core of this work are two guiding frameworks—GETS (Goals, Expectations, Target Learners, and Situation) and GOOPS (Goals, Objectives, Outcomes, Purpose, and Success)—which serve as analytical tools for making intentional and transparent decisions in curriculum and instructional design (CID). These frameworks are complemented by practical models such as TIPP (Teaching Inventory of Practice and Preferences), the GPS presentation model, and the Critical Learning Path (CLP), allowing readers to diagnose needs, align strategies, and assess results across various educational contexts. This book recognizes CID as a dynamic, iterative, and inclusive process that must adapt to the needs of diverse learners and institutions. It empowers practitioners to reflect critically on their roles, values, and methods while embracing the collaborative potential of transdisciplinary innovation. From foundational theories to real-world case studies—including insights from NSF-funded projects—readers will find tools to navigate complexity, foster engagement, and drive systemic transformation in education. Rather than prescribing a singular approach, this volume encourages reflective adaptation, making it a valuable resource for faculty, curriculum committees, accreditors, and educational policymakers. Mapping Constructively Aligned Curriculum and Instructional Design is more than a book—it is a call to co-create educational futures through clarity, alignment, and purpose-driven collaboration.
